How to fill out in-school community service opportunities

How to fill out in-school community service opportunities:
01
Start by researching the available community service opportunities within your school. This can be done by talking to school administrators, teachers, or checking the school's website for any announcements or listings.
02
Once you have identified the opportunities, consider your interests, skills, and passions. Choose a community service activity that aligns with your personal preferences, as it will make the experience more enjoyable and meaningful for you.
03
Contact the person or organization in charge of the service opportunity to express your interest and inquire about any specific requirements or guidelines. This could include filling out an application form or attending an orientation session.
04
Fill out any necessary paperwork or applications accurately and thoroughly. Provide all the requested information, such as contact details, availability, and any previous community service experience you may have. Take the time to review your responses before submitting.
05
If required, participate in any training or orientation sessions provided by the organization or school. This will help you understand the purpose, expectations, and guidelines of the community service opportunity.
06
Set a schedule and commit to the service opportunity by ensuring you are available for the designated hours or time frame. Be punctual and reliable, as this reflects your commitment and professionalism.
07
Throughout your community service, maintain a positive attitude, engage with others, and take initiative. Show enthusiasm and willingness to learn and contribute to the cause, making the most out of your experience.
08
Reflect on your community service experience and consider the impact it had on both the community and yourself. Evaluate what you have learned, the challenges you faced, and how the experience has influenced your perspective or values.
09
Finally, document your community service hours and any significant achievements or outcomes. Keep a record of your service, including dates, times, tasks performed, and any feedback received. This can be useful for future references or including in college applications or resumes.
